Explore the role of neutrinos in cosmology in this third lecture by Yvonne Wong, part of the "Understanding the Universe Through Neutrinos" program at the International Centre for Theoretical Sciences. Delve into the connections between particle physics and the early universe, examining how neutrinos influence cosmic evolution and structure formation. Learn about the cosmic neutrino background, its detection challenges, and its implications for our understanding of the universe's history and composition. Investigate current research on neutrino mass constraints from cosmological observations and discuss potential future developments in neutrino cosmology. Gain insights into how this elusive particle shapes our cosmic landscape and contributes to our quest to unravel the mysteries of the universe.
